Discovering New Talent: Where Paper Collective Finds Emerging Artists

Paper Collective actively seeks out emerging artists through multiple channels. One key method is attending art fairs, graduate shows, and design festivals around Europe. The team keeps a close eye on art schools and independent studios, looking for fresh perspectives and unique styles that resonate with contemporary interiors.

Social media also plays a role. Artists often tag Paper Collective in their work, and the curation team regularly scouts platforms like Instagram for hidden gems. They prioritize originality and versatility—art that can work in a variety of spaces, from minimalist homes to eclectic offices.

  • Graduate exhibitions from top art schools
  • Independent art fairs and design weeks
  • Social media platforms like Instagram and Behance
  • Direct submissions via the Paper Collective website

The Collaboration Process: From Concept to Print

Once an artist catches the team's attention, the collaboration begins with a conversation. Paper Collective values artistic freedom, so they rarely dictate themes. Instead, they ask artists to submit a portfolio of existing work or propose new ideas. The curation team then selects pieces that fit the brand's aesthetic—bold yet timeless, with a strong visual impact.

After selecting a design, Paper Collective works with the artist to refine the artwork for print. This includes color calibration, sizing, and ensuring the piece translates well to different formats like art cards, acoustic panels, or framed prints. The artist retains full copyright and receives a royalty on every sale, fostering a fair and sustainable partnership.

  • Artists retain copyright and receive royalties
  • Collaborative refinement for print quality
  • Options to produce as art cards or acoustic panels

Why Supporting Emerging Artists Matters

By collaborating with emerging artists, Paper Collective democratizes art in two ways: it makes original designs affordable for consumers, and it provides a platform for artists to gain exposure and income. Many of these artists have gone on to exhibit in galleries or collaborate with major brands, thanks to the visibility from Paper Collective.

For buyers, owning a print from an emerging artist means owning something unique—often before the artist gains widespread recognition. It’s a way to invest in art that feels personal and connected to the creative community.

  • Affordable access to original contemporary art
  • Artists gain global exposure and fair compensation
  • Each print supports the next generation of creators
